posted March 20, 2020 #

Today, March 20th, 2020, Bandcamp is waiving their fee on digital sales. This means that instead of an 85% / 15% split between the artist and the platform, 100% of sales goes to the artist. I've been a huge proponent of Bandcamp since the very first YK Records release and remain so to this day.

If you feel so inclined, here’s a list of recent-ish releases from the label you can purchase to support our artists. Listing everything would be overwhelming, so just use this as a jumping off point to explore and enjoy!
